The Lean Six Sigma Green Belt operates in support of or under the supervision of a Six Sigma Black Belt, analyzes and solves quality problems and is involved in quality improvement projects. A Green Belt is someone with at least three years of work experience who wants to demonstrate his or her knowledge of Six Sigma tools and processes.

Lean Six Sigma Green Belt Course:

This course is designed to provide an understanding of the Lean Six Sigma Green Belt areas of knowledge.

The Define-Measure-Analyze-Improve-Control "DMAIC" methodology is presented with numerous case studies and examples drawn from service, business process, and manufacturing applications. Selected Lean Manufacturing and System Dynamics concepts are integrated with Six Sigma in this course, including value stream mapping, Takt time, line balancing, standardized work, continuous flow, Little’s Law, Kaizen, quick changeovers, and pull scheduling.

This course is instructor lead, deliverd in a state of the art class room with full multi-media capability and wifi. Each session is 3.75 hours. In order to sucessfully complete this course students will need to commit to an addtional 10 hours per week of study outside the classroom.

  • Upon the completion of this course, you will be able to:
  • Lead teams in applying the Six Sigma D-M-A-I-C methodology to eliminate waste
  • Define improvement projects to satisfy the customer
  • Measure inputs and outputs to provide meaningful data
  • Analyze data to identify the root cause of variability
  • Improve the process to reduce variability
  • Control the process to prevent backsliding and consolidate the gains
